Action item from the Relayfin outage review: websocket compression saved bandwidth but cost us CPU headroom during the spike. Per-message deflate was enabled fleet-wide without profiling small payloads, where compression overhead exceeds savings. Tomas will gate compression by payload size and connection tier before next release. The agreed starting values for the size threshold and window bits are below.

tuning table, yajog-yahof:
BUDGETS = {
    "lamvan": 303,
    "wenox": 460,
    "fenvan": 525,
}

Subject: GPU profiler cut-over done

Welcome aboard — as of last night, the Tracegrove profiler replaced our old memory-sampling scripts across all training nodes on the Verdane cluster. Allocation snapshots are now continuous rather than on-demand, and overhead stayed under two percent in validation. Per-node agents were restarted cleanly. The agents run with these settings:

service settings:
PRAIX_LOG_LEVEL=error
PRAIX_METRICS_HOST=metrics.praix.qorvelcorp.corp
PRAIX_POOL_SIZE=16

ALERT: Gatekite gateway is shedding traffic on the internal routes tier. Rate-limit buckets for the Fernhollow services exhausted at 14:02 and retries are amplifying load. Checkout and ledger calls are degraded; release train Maple-12 should hold until throttles recover. On-call has frozen config pushes. Do not promote the pending build. Current limiter status and per-route counters are on the dashboard below.

wiki page, tahaf-tajog: https://jira.ordindyn.corp/pipeline

/*
 * Client setup for Prunebot, our stale-branch cleanup service.
 * Prunebot scans the Hollowfork git mirror every six hours and
 * deletes branches with no commits in 90 days, excluding anything
 * matching the protected-branch patterns in prune_rules.yaml.
 * If cleanup runs start failing with 401s, the usual cause is
 * token rotation on the Hollowfork side outpacing our cache; a
 * restart forces a refresh. The client authenticates to the
 * internal Hollowfork API with the key that follows below.
 */

app token of bawep-hafog = kto7_vwrmnlx